Recognizing the Need for Professional Wildlife Control
Sometimes it's not immediately obvious that you have a wildlife problem. However, there are several common signs that indicate it's time to call in the professionals for wildlife control in Catalina Foothills, AZ.
Unusual Noises at Night or Dawn/Dusk
One of the most common indicators of wildlife presence is strange noises coming from your walls, attic, crawl space, or even under your deck. Scratching, scurrying, chirping, or thumping sounds, especially during the late evening or early morning hours, can indicate animals like squirrels, raccoons, bats, or birds have taken up residence. These noises can be more than just an annoyance; they can signal potential damage being done out of sight. Visible Damage to Your Property
Wildlife can cause significant damage to your home's exterior and interior. This can include chewed electrical wires (a serious fire hazard), damaged insulation, torn screens, gnawed wood, or dug-up gardens and lawns. Birds might build nests in vents or gutters, causing blockages. Raccoons might tear open garbage cans. Squirrels might chew on siding or trim. Strong or Unpleasant Odors
The presence of wildlife, especially in confined spaces, often results in strong, unpleasant odors. This can be due to urine, feces, or even decaying carcasses. These odors are not only offensive but can also attract other pests and pose health risks. If you notice persistent, unidentifiable smells coming from your attic, walls, or other areas, it's worth investigating for a potential wildlife intrusion. Pet Behavior Changes
Your pets might be the first to alert you to the presence of unwanted wildlife. Dogs might bark obsessively at certain areas of the house or yard, or they might be unusually agitated. Cats might stare intently at walls or ceilings where animals are nesting. Changes in your pet's behavior, particularly if they are focused on specific locations, can be a strong indicator of hidden wildlife activity. Common Wildlife Species in Catalina Foothills
The diverse ecosystem of Catalina Foothills supports a variety of wildlife species that can sometimes become unwelcome visitors to homes and businesses. Understanding the behavior and habits of these animals helps us provide more effective control. Some of the common species we encounter include:
- Raccoons: Known for their intelligence and dexterity, raccoons can gain access to attics, chimneys, and garbage cans. They can cause significant damage and carry diseases.
- Squirrels: these active rodents can chew through wood and wires, build nests in attics and walls, and damage gardens. Squirrel removal is a common request.
- Bats: While beneficial insect eaters, bats can roost in attics and walls, creating unpleasant odors and potential health risks from their guano.
- Birds: Certain bird species can build nests in vents, gutters, and under eaves, causing blockages and potential damage.
- Snakes: While many snakes are harmless, some venomous species are found in Arizona, posing a risk to people and pets.
- Coyotes: Although they typically avoid humans, coyotes can pose a threat to pets and livestock, especially in more rural areas of Catalina Foothills.
- Skunks: Known for their potent spray, skunks can den under porches or sheds and become a nuisance.
Each of these species requires a specific approach to removal and prevention. Understanding the Risks Associated with Wildlife
It's important to understand that wildlife can pose various risks to your health and safety. Many animals carry diseases that can be transmitted to humans and pets, such as rabies, leptospirosis, and hantavirus. Animal droppings can also contain harmful bacteria and parasites. Additionally, aggressive wildlife can pose a direct threat, especially if they feel cornered or are protecting their young. Attempting to handle wildlife yourself without proper protection can increase these risks.
